Overview
The MAD XP6 KV180 is a high-performance integrated drone arm set, engineered for agricultural UAVs and light transport drones. Designed with a modular structure, this unit combines the motor, ESC, propeller, and arm into a single waterproof system that simplifies assembly, improves operational reliability, and reduces the likelihood of failure during complex missions. With a maximum thrust of 9.5 kg and full IPX6 protection, it is ideal for demanding field operations requiring consistent output and environmental resilience.

Performance Test Results (12S Battery, 22x7.0 Propeller)
Throttle (%) | Thrust (gf) | Input Power (W) | Efficiency (gf/W) |
---|---|---|---|
30 | 1613 | 155.4 | 10 |
50 | 3577 | 463.2 | 8 |
75 | 6885 | 1184.1 | 6 |
100 | 9589 | 2028.9 | 5 |
-
Peak efficiency: 10 gf/W at 30–35% throttle
-
Max thrust: 9589 gf (9.5 kgf) at full throttle
